First, there was a conservatory founded in 1850 by Renée Maubel, which included studios of rehearsals and a hall where Raimu, Frehel and Pierre Fresnay were included. Unfortunately, it was seriously deteriorated in the 1970 s. In 1984, Michel Galabru bought her, retyping her and confided it to his daughter Emma, who named the theater place Maubel-Galabru, then Montmartre-Galabru. Here you will find a hundred spectators of comedy, musical shows, one man shows and children's shows.
